func readSetCookies()

in garbage/nethttp.go [659:742]


func readSetCookies(h Header) []*Cookie {
	cookies := []*Cookie{}
	for _, line := range h["Set-Cookie"] {
		parts := strings.Split(strings.TrimSpace(line), ";")
		if len(parts) == 1 && parts[0] == "" {
			continue
		}
		parts[0] = strings.TrimSpace(parts[0])
		j := strings.Index(parts[0], "=")
		if j < 0 {
			continue
		}
		name, value := parts[0][:j], parts[0][j+1:]
		if !isCookieNameValid(name) {
			continue
		}
		value, success := parseCookieValue(value, true)
		if !success {
			continue
		}
		c := &Cookie{
			Name:  name,
			Value: value,
			Raw:   line,
		}
		for i := 1; i < len(parts); i++ {
			parts[i] = strings.TrimSpace(parts[i])
			if len(parts[i]) == 0 {
				continue
			}

			attr, val := parts[i], ""
			if j := strings.Index(attr, "="); j >= 0 {
				attr, val = attr[:j], attr[j+1:]
			}
			lowerAttr := strings.ToLower(attr)
			val, success = parseCookieValue(val, false)
			if !success {
				c.Unparsed = append(c.Unparsed, parts[i])
				continue
			}
			switch lowerAttr {
			case "secure":
				c.Secure = true
				continue
			case "httponly":
				c.HttpOnly = true
				continue
			case "domain":
				c.Domain = val
				continue
			case "max-age":
				secs, err := strconv.Atoi(val)
				if err != nil || secs != 0 && val[0] == '0' {
					break
				}
				if secs <= 0 {
					c.MaxAge = -1
				} else {
					c.MaxAge = secs
				}
				continue
			case "expires":
				c.RawExpires = val
				exptime, err := time.Parse(time.RFC1123, val)
				if err != nil {
					exptime, err = time.Parse("Mon, 02-Jan-2006 15:04:05 MST", val)
					if err != nil {
						c.Expires = time.Time{}
						break
					}
				}
				c.Expires = exptime.UTC()
				continue
			case "path":
				c.Path = val
				continue
			}
			c.Unparsed = append(c.Unparsed, parts[i])
		}
		cookies = append(cookies, c)
	}
	return cookies
}
